I would like to take a moment to recap some of today’s highlights:
1.We are confident in our go-forward plans to design and execute a Phase 3 clinical trial program that will support approval and commercialization of our KOA candidate as a potential blockbuster biologic opportunity. Third-party biostatisticians validated the statistically significant and clinically meaningful improvement in WOMAC Pain at three and six months, respectively (p=0.032 and p=0.009), WOMAC Function (p=0.046 and p=0.009), and WOMAC Total (p=0.038 and p=0.008) for the Pre-Interim Analysis Cohort of 190 patients in our Phase 2B KOA trial. The intensive root-cause analysis trial revealed that the potency of the investigational product faded as it aged, resulting in failure to meet primary endpoints.
2.We now have a clear path forward and are confident in MIMEDX’s proprietary tissue engineering know-how and manufacturing processes. Benefitted by the learnings from the Phase 2B KOA exploratory clinical trial, we believe the Company has an increased probability of success as we proceed with two confirmatory Phase 3 trials in KOA. We plan to initiate these Phase 3 trials commencing in 2022 and anticipate filing a BLA in late 2025. We will, of course, work closely with the U.S. Food & Drug Administration (FDA) in advancing these Phase 3 trials.
3.We believe the evidence supporting the therapeutic potential of mdHACM is compelling based on: (1) Statistically significant and clinically meaningful data from the 190 Pre-Interim Analysis Cohort in the Phase 2B trial; (2) Published retrospective studies; (3) Extensive real-world clinical use; and (4) Ongoing scientific mechanism of action research.
4.Our commercial business is strong, and we project it can grow at a sustainable 11-14% annual rate as we expand into areas of surgical recovery and new geographical markets.
